Transaction 8dfafad85b63a999df266f267fd13ac18ce8963a7ed788ef0e26020ae8e123e2
1 Input
1 Output
-
8dfafad85b63a999df266f267fd13ac18ce8963a7ed788ef0e26020ae8e123e2:0
- value
- 3113320
- script pubkey
- OP_0 OP_PUSHBYTES_20 2abaae214d88dfff85787b9e95c55e7389debe09
- address
- bc1q92a2ug2d3r0llptc0w0ft327wwyaa0sfhh0s7k